2025 CRV passenger seat height

Anonymous
We have a 2025 CRV EX-L on hold, but my main concern is passenger seat height. I ride in that seat most of the time, and as a 5 foot 4 inch woman, I like to be upright a bit in SUVs. Our other options have more maintenance issues (Tiguan, XC60), but have height adjustable seats. Do any CRV owners car to weigh in on the passenger seat? I have sat in it and it felt lower than optimal, but will I likely get used to it?
